A Multi‐Century Meteo‐Hydrological Analysis in the Italian Alps: Daily Streamflow (1862–2022) at Different Time Scales

open access: yesHydrological Processes, Volume 39, Issue 11, November 2025.
The second longest time series (1862–2022) for Italy and possibly the Mediterranean area of daily hydrometric levels and streamflow data was reconstructed for the Adige river basin, in the Italian Alps (9793 km2). Annual precipitation is stationary and annual streamflow is significantly declining at a rate of −1.0 mm year−1 corresponding to −1.3 ...

Aerobic Exercise Training Exerts Neuroprotective Effects in Alzheimer's Disease Mice by Regulating Endoplasmic Reticulum Stress‐Autophagy Pathway‐Mediated Pyroptosis

open access: yesCNS Neuroscience &Therapeutics, Volume 31, Issue 11, November 2025.
Aerobic exercise training regulates the ERS‐autophagy pathway‐mediated cell pyroptosis by inhibiting the PERK‐elF2a pathway, and reduces the deposition of Aß and p‐Tau, thereby reducing nerve injury in the hippocampal CA1 region and improving cognitive function in AD mice.
